Output 58fc9d44cc3efaebc60d171fa304782d3f0bbf719cf86aa740a01c3a255a392c:72

value
100829818
script pubkey
OP_0 OP_PUSHBYTES_20 f666766105ce94e57b0c174097ad732d0dc9b30e
address
bc1q7en8vcg9e62w27cvzaqf0ttn95xunvcww00ahk
transaction
58fc9d44cc3efaebc60d171fa304782d3f0bbf719cf86aa740a01c3a255a392c
spent
true